zoukankan      html  css  js  c++  java
  • 问题解决--无法解析的外部符号 _imp_XXXXXXXXX

    错误示例:

     

    出现字符_imp,说明不是真正的静态库,而是某个动态库的导入库,导入函数和自己不同名,所以加了字符_imp。比如说_imp_GetUserNameA就是GetUserNameA函数。

    会报这种错误,说明注册表函数没有相关的lib库,我们需要在MSDN下搜索函数。

    解决方法:

    1、打开MSDN,点击右上角的搜索:

    MSDN网址:http://msdn.microsoft.com/en-us/dn308572.aspx

    2、搜索之后,会出现多条搜索记录,选择一条点击进入:

    3、里面会有这个函数的详细介绍,找到它所在的lib库:

    4、将Advapi32.lib添加到代码工程中,即可解决问题。

    #pragma comment(lib, "Advapi32.lib")
    

  • 相关阅读:
    每日日报
    Java学习
    Java学习
    Java学习
    Java学习
    Java学习
    Java学习
    Java学习
    Java学习
    JAVA日报
  • 原文地址:https://www.cnblogs.com/xue0708/p/10168016.html
Copyright © 2011-2022 走看看